DRAFT STATEMENT OF WORK (SOW):
DRAFT Statement of Work (SOW) - Procurement of CRAC Unit Precision Cooling
1.0 General
This Statement of Work (SOW) outlines the requirements for the procurement and delivery of Computer Room Air Conditioning (CRAC) unit. The CRAC unit is required by MANN GRANDSTAFF VA Medical Center Spokane, WA. to replace an aged 25-year-old unit obsolete unit.
2.0 Scope of Work
The Vendor shall furnish the latest model CRAC unit, compliant with the specifications outlined in Section 3.0. The scope of work includes, but is not limited to:
Procurement:Â Supply of the specified CRAC units as detailed in the Equipment List (Section 3.1).
Delivery:Â Delivery of the CRAC unit to 4815 N. Assembly Street, Spokane, WA. 99208. Required Delivery Date: 10/01/25.
Documentation:Â Providing all necessary documentation, including but not limited to:
Manufacturer's technical data sheets
Installation, operation, and maintenance manuals
Warranty information
3.0 Equipment List
Location
Quantity
Specifications
Design Basis
Telecomm Room Building 1 Room B0114A-CRAC
1
2800 CFM, 63 KBTU/HR, at Approx 75F-45%RH 208/60V-3Ph-60Hz, 76.5 FLA., 81.5 WSA,90 OPD, Up flow
VERTIV PX018UA1CB
3.1 General Requirements
Compliance:Â The CRAC units shall comply with all applicable ASHRAE, ASME, and UL standards.
Systems Details:
Up flow with front air return
ICOM control with high-definition display
ICOM based comms BACnet
Variable speed EC plug fans
digital scroll variable capacity compressor utilizing environmental approved refrigerant.
Evaporator type tilted-slab, cooper tubes, aluminum fins with hydrophilic coating
infrared humidification
65,000Amp, rms short circuit current rating
locking disconnect switch
Dual-float CONDENSATE PUMP FACTORY MOUNTED INTERNAL TO UNIT
Filter rating MERV 13 per ASHRAE
Supply air sensor
Smoke sensor
Temperature/humidity sensors internal for return air sensing
one remote shut down contact
three alarm contacts
discharge grill plenum-3 way discharge
Point LEAK DETECTION SENSOR
Air cooled microchannel condenser/ 208 v/3 PHASE. 60Hz, 2.3FLA,209WSA,15OPD
Dimensions:
Height: no more than 77 9/16
Width: 34 ½
Depth:34 5/8
4.0 Deliverables
The Contractor shall deliver the following:
CRAC units as specified in Section 3.0.
All required documentation as outlined in Section 2.0.
Equipment shall be secured & packaged for outdoor, uncovered storage until installation.
Delivery shall take place at: Delivery of the CRAC unit to 4815 N. Assembly Street, Spokane, WA. 99208. Required Delivery Date: 10/01/25.
5.0 Warranty
The CRAC units shall be covered by a comprehensive manufacturer's warranty.
